Nestled at the foot of the majestic limestone mountains in Gia Vien district ( Ninh Binh ), Van Long lagoon is known as the "waveless bay" of the North. Not as bustling as Trang An or Tam Coc, Bich Dong, Van Long has a quiet, poetic beauty, making anyone who visits feel like their soul is cleansed by the rare peace. Photo Visit Ninh Binh
Van Long Lagoon is the largest wetland nature reserve in the Northern Delta, with an area of nearly 3,500 hectares. This place stands out with its mirror-like calm water surface, reflecting the overlapping limestone mountains and rich vegetation. Photo: Visit Ninh Binh
The special thing is that the water surface here has almost no waves, so this place is also called by the romantic name: "waveless bay". Photo Visit Ninh Binh
The experience of sitting on a bamboo boat, weaving through clear streams, following the foot of limestone mountains is an activity that any tourist cannot miss. Photo: Visit Ninh Binh
The journey takes visitors through amazing natural caves such as Ca cave, Bong cave, Rua cave... each cave is associated with an interesting folk story. Photo: Visit Ninh Binh
In the afternoon, the sunlight shines through the water, creating sparkling streaks of light like gold, making the scene even more magical. Photo: Visit Ninh Binh
Not only is it a prominent scenic spot, Van Long Lagoon is also the largest wetland nature reserve in the Northern Delta, home to many rare species of flora and fauna, especially the white-cheeked langur - an extremely endangered primate species in the world . Photo: travel
If lucky, visitors can catch sight of groups of langurs swinging from branch to branch, playing on the cliffs – a special and unforgettable experience. Photo: Beomhaww__
